
Cypriot public broadcaster CYBC has announced that Greek singer Elena Tsagrinou will represent the sunny Mediterranean island at Eurovision 2021 in Rotterdam. Elena will sing the song El Diablo which will be released at a later date
CYBC have already announced the artistic director for their 2021 entry, and it happens to be Austrian Martin Deimann, the very man behind Austria’s winning entrant in 2014, Conchita Wurst, and also Austria’s 2018 entrant Cesár Sampson who finished 3rd in the Grand Final.
Cyprus debuted at Eurovision in 1981 with the group Island and finishing 6th with the song Monika. Cyprus has participated at every contest since except for 1988, 2001 and 2014. The island has achieved a mixture of results in its history, with their best result in 2018 when Eleni Foureira finished 2nd with the song Fuego. In 2020, Sandro was internally selected to represent Cyprus with song Running. However, Eurovision 2020 was cancelled due to the current Covid-19 pandemic and it was confirmed in June 2020 that Sandro would not return for Cyprus for the 2021 contest.
